Output 73cc62cf0e053fa66827ef1413f184f4d2bbea31eb9b8724df9ab1f48f5d5969:1

value
10518247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2967abd21ecb2490531c5d81f90b06af7c0faf7e OP_EQUAL
address
MBg68VebKXsyxpog48KEGwZ56mm4CAVTGw
transaction
73cc62cf0e053fa66827ef1413f184f4d2bbea31eb9b8724df9ab1f48f5d5969
spent
true